Originally posted on The Scrap Shoppe -- but I wanted to share the tutorial with y'all in case you missed it. These have been very popular and I have made lots for gifts. They are one of my favorite ornaments too...
You will need some wood united states cutouts. I got mine on etsy. In writing this post, I found out that she does not have anymore of these. I have scoured the internet for a source but have not found one. There are sources that cut custom shapes from wood that you could use. If anyone finds these exact cutouts please let me know. Otherwise you handy women with a jigsaw will have to make your own.
I didn't even break out the drill. I just used a small screw driver to put a hole in my cutout.
Paint with as many coats of white as it takes. I used my fave Decoart Designer series paint.
Print out a map of the US with the state outlines that is about the same size as your wood piece...
Lay the paper on top of your wood and trace around with a ball point pen. The pen will make a slight indention in the wood. Then you just fill the indention with your gray paint.
I then just added a heart in the approximate location of the city.
Add a ribbon to hang and you are done. These are easy and oh so personal! A great addition to any Christmas tree.
